スタンドアロンアプリケーションとは?
意味・定義
スタンドアロンアプリケーションとは、他のソフトウェアやプラットフォームに依存せずに単体で動作するアプリケーションを指します。これにより、ユーザーは特定の環境や外部のリソースに影響されることなく、アプリケーションを利用できるのが特徴です。例えば、インストール型のソフトウェアや、特定のハードウェア上で動作するプログラムが該当します。スタンドアロンアプリは、特にオフライン環境やセキュリティが求められる状況での利用が多いです。
目的・背景
スタンドアロンアプリケーションは、ユーザーがインターネット接続や他のソフトウェアの影響を受けずに利用できる利点があります。これにより、ネットワークの不安定さや外部システムの変更による影響を排除できます。特に、重要な業務データを扱うシステムでは、他の依存関係を持たないことがセキュリティ上のメリットとなります。また、開発者側でも、特定の環境に依存せずに製品を提供できるため、開発プロセスがシンプルになるという利点があります。
使い方・具体例
- オフラインで使用するデータ管理ソフトウェアとして、特定の業務に特化したアプリケーションが開発されることがある。
- 組織内で利用される業務支援ツールとして、インターネット接続なしでも機能するアプリが導入される。
- 学校や教育機関で、教育用ソフトウェアが生徒のパソコンに直接インストールされ、授業中に使用される場合がある。
- 特定のハードウェアに依存したシステムが設計され、特定の機能を実行するためにスタンドアロンで動作することが求められる。
- セキュリティが重視される環境で、外部との接続を持たずにデータを処理する必要があるため、スタンドアロンのアプリケーションが選ばれる。
関連用語
試験対策や体系的な理解を目的とする場合、以下の用語もあわせて確認しておくと安心です。
まとめ
- スタンドアロンアプリケーションは、他のソフトウェアに依存せずに動作するアプリケーションである。
- セキュリティ向上や運用の効率化を図るために利用されることが多い。
- 業務や教育現場での利用が一般的で、特定の環境での安定性を提供する。
現場メモ
スタンドアロンアプリケーションを導入する際には、ユーザーの操作性を考慮することが重要です。特に、操作手順が複雑になると、利用者が戸惑う可能性があります。また、定期的なアップデートやメンテナンスが必要な場合もあるため、使用環境をあらかじめ整備しておくことが望ましいです。